What color suit with champagne dress?
November 21, 2025 · caitlin
To achieve a polished and stylish look when pairing a suit with a champagne dress, consider colors that complement the soft, neutral tones of champagne. Ideal suit colors include navy blue, charcoal gray, and classic black, which offer a sophisticated contrast. These choices ensure a cohesive and elegant appearance for any formal occasion.
What Suit Colors Complement a Champagne Dress?
Choosing the right suit color to wear with a champagne dress can enhance the overall aesthetic of your ensemble. Here are some of the best options:
- Navy Blue: This classic color provides a striking contrast to the warm tones of champagne, creating a balanced and refined look.
- Charcoal Gray: A versatile choice, charcoal gray suits offer a subtle elegance that pairs well with the understated hue of champagne.
- Black: A timeless option, black suits deliver a sleek and formal appearance, making them a safe choice for evening events.
Why Choose Navy Blue?
Navy blue is a popular choice for pairing with champagne dresses due to its deep, rich hue that complements the lightness of champagne. This color combination works well for both daytime and evening events, offering versatility and elegance.
- Versatility: Navy suits can be worn for various occasions, from weddings to business events.
- Contrast: The dark shade of navy provides a striking contrast to champagne, highlighting the dress’s subtle tones.
- Accessories: Navy pairs well with a range of accessories, allowing for creative expression with ties and pocket squares.
Is Charcoal Gray a Good Option?
Charcoal gray is an excellent choice for those seeking a more subdued yet sophisticated look. This color provides a harmonious balance with champagne, making it ideal for formal settings.
- Subtle Elegance: Charcoal gray’s neutral tone complements champagne without overpowering it.
- Modern Appeal: This color is perfect for contemporary styles, offering a sleek and polished appearance.
- Seasonal Flexibility: Charcoal gray suits work well in any season, making them a versatile addition to your wardrobe.
When to Wear a Black Suit?
Black suits are a classic choice for formal occasions and pair beautifully with champagne dresses. They offer a timeless and elegant look that is always appropriate.
- Formal Events: Black suits are ideal for evening events and black-tie affairs.
- Timeless Style: The classic appeal of black ensures that your ensemble remains stylish and sophisticated.
- Ease of Coordination: Black suits are easy to coordinate with various accessories, allowing for personal style expression.
Additional Considerations for Pairing Suits with Champagne Dresses
When selecting a suit to pair with a champagne dress, consider the following factors to ensure a cohesive look:
- Fabric Texture: Choose suit fabrics that complement the dress’s material, such as satin or silk, for a harmonious appearance.
- Accessories: Coordinate ties, pocket squares, and shoes to enhance the overall look. Consider metallic accents like gold or silver for added elegance.
- Season: Adapt your suit choice to the season, opting for lighter fabrics in summer and heavier materials in winter.
How to Accessorize a Suit with a Champagne Dress?
Accessorizing is key to completing your look. Here are some tips:
- Ties and Pocket Squares: Choose colors that complement both the suit and the dress. Consider shades like burgundy or emerald for a pop of color.
- Shoes: Opt for classic black or brown shoes, depending on the suit color. Ensure they are polished and in good condition.
- Jewelry: For added elegance, incorporate metallic accessories that match the dress’s undertones, such as gold or silver.

What Shoes Should I Wear with a Champagne Dress?
For a champagne dress, opt for shoes in neutral tones like nude or metallic shades such as gold or silver. These colors complement the dress without overpowering it, maintaining a cohesive and elegant look.
Can I Wear a Brown Suit with a Champagne Dress?
Yes, a brown suit can work with a champagne dress, especially in lighter shades like tan or camel. These colors create a warm, harmonious look, suitable for daytime events or outdoor weddings.
What Tie Color Goes with a Champagne Dress?
Tie colors that complement a champagne dress include deep jewel tones like burgundy or emerald, as well as classic choices like navy or black. These colors add sophistication and contrast to your ensemble.
Is a White Suit Appropriate with a Champagne Dress?
A white suit can be a bold choice, offering a modern and fresh look. However, ensure that the shades of white and champagne do not clash. This combination is best suited for daytime events or summer weddings.
How Can I Match a Champagne Dress for a Wedding?
To match a champagne dress for a wedding, select a suit in a complementary color like navy, charcoal gray, or black. Coordinate with accessories that enhance the overall look, such as metallic jewelry and polished shoes.
